① 如何用Excel VBA做股票量化交易系統(原創
先學會VBA和股票交易規則,再寫代碼來實現
② 如何用EXCEL VBA寫量化交易系統
1、 這個沒有現成的程序,有都是要收費的
2 、可以在網上找一些資料自己研究,但估計回比較難找
3 、excel獲取股票的交易信息這個網上有一些資料,但是控制交易好像是沒有的。
4、 具體來看樓主是什麼需求
5、下面是網上的一篇文章,可以參考一下
量化交易
③ 求 EXCEL 自動獲取全部股票近幾天的收盤價的 VBA程序
我只會從安裝的本地文件下載的數據中獲得數據轉化成Excel的表格。
④ EXCEL如何用VBA自動獲取每個股票近幾天的漲幅
一般網頁上的數據都可以通過VBA進行抓取,應用得好,可以實現對很很多資料的動態監測。
漲幅就是指目前這只股票的上漲幅度。
漲幅的計算公式:漲幅=(現價-上一個交易日收盤價)/上一個交易日收盤價*100%
例如:某隻股票價格上一個交易日收盤價100,次日現價為110.01,就是股價漲幅為(110.01-100 )/100*100%=10.01%.一般對於股票來說 就是漲停了!如果漲幅為0則表示今天沒漲沒跌,價格和前一個交易日持平。如果漲幅為負則稱為跌幅。
比如:一支股票的漲幅是:10%、-5%等 。
⑤ Excel VBA抓取股價分時圖問題
文件發我看看
[email protected]
⑥ 怎麼利用vba獲取財經網上股票股價的實時數據
你願意出錢嗎,願意出錢的話我可以幫你寫
⑦ 如何用excel獲得股票實時數據
編寫VBA。且有點難度。
⑧ 想要開發一個股票交易軟體 需要怎樣獲取實時數據 數據介面
惠德贏策 大家記住了啊,這個垃圾公司老闆叫:祝清。公司內部垃圾就算了,公司出的產品都是騙人的,還有他們開發的一個模擬炒股的網站要交錢才能炒股,都是騙人的,大家千萬別上當受騙,這家公司老闆超級卑鄙,合夥別人把他原來的公司給搞垮自己開公司,不過心在自己公司也快倒閉了,員工工資都發布出來了,哈哈,真雞-巴爽呀,那個B兒子真沒話說了。
我就是受害者呀,噴血相告,切記呀
⑨ 那位高手可以幫忙,將「金字塔決策交易系統」中的行情數據用VBA實時導入到EXCEL中
SubSavetoExcel()
Ktime=3'3分鍾K線
'使用前請注意將K線主圖打開,
'得到框架名稱為"Technic",窗格名稱為"Main"的窗格對象
SetGrid=Technic.GetGridByName("Main")
SetHistory=Grid.GetHistoryData()
CountStart=InputBox("起始序號:",1)
CountLength=InputBox("長度:",1)
'創建EXCEL對象
SetobjExcel=CreateObject("Excel.Application")
objExcel.Visible=True
objExcel.Workbooks.Add
fori=0toCountLength-1
j=CountStart+i-1
ifj<History.Countthen
objExcel.Cells(i+1,1).Value=History.Date(j)
objExcel.Cells(i+1,2).Value=History.Open(j)
objExcel.Cells(i+1,3).Value=History.Close(j)
objExcel.Cells(i+1,4).Value=History.High(j)
objExcel.Cells(i+1,5).Value=History.Low(j)
endif
next
MsgBox("OK")
EndSub
這是我用的,保存k線數據,不過速度很慢(不要指望金字塔會讓你很爽)
⑩ 用VB如何直接獲取股票實時數據
可以通過調用ChinaStockWebService的服務來實現獲取股票的實時數據,代碼如下:
publicstring[]getStockInfo(stringstockcode)
{
//stringurl="http://hq.sinajs.cn/list="+stockcode;
//stockcode某隻股票的代碼
stringurl="http://hq.sinajs.cn/list=sh600683";
WebClientclient=newWebClient();
client.Headers.Add("Content-Type","text/html;charset=gb2312");
Streamdata=client.OpenRead(url);
StreamReaderreader=newStreamReader(data,Encoding.GetEncoding("gb2312"));
strings=reader.ReadToEnd();
reader.Close();
data.Close();
returns.Split(',');
}